What are high fat foods?

Foods high in saturated fats

  • fatty cuts of meat.
  • meat products, including sausages and pies.
  • butter, ghee, and lard.
  • cheese, especially hard cheese like cheddar.
  • cream, soured cream and ice cream.
  • some savoury snacks, like cheese crackers and some popcorns.
  • chocolate confectionery.
  • biscuits, cakes, and pastries.

Are eggs high in fat?

Fat Content

One egg has 5 grams of fat (about 8 percent of daily value), of which only 1.5 grams is saturated. Because eggs are often enjoyed with high-fat foods such as cheese (in scrambled or omelets) or fried with bacon and sausage, they are seen as a high-fat food — but that's simply by association.

What are the best fats to eat?

Choose foods with “good” unsaturated fats, limit foods high in saturated fat, and avoid “bad” trans fat. “Good” unsaturated fats — Monounsaturated and polyunsaturated fats — lower disease risk. Foods high in good fats include vegetable oils (such as olive, canola, sunflower, soy, and corn), nuts, seeds, and fish.

Is peanut butter a healthy fat?

The healthy fats in peanut butter are called monounsaturated and polyunsaturated fatty acids. These fats are associated with a lower risk of weight gain and obesity when consumed as part of a healthy diet.

Is peanut butter high in fat?

Since peanut butter is very high in fat, a 3.5-ounce (100-gram) portion contains a hefty dose of 597 calories ( 4 ). Despite their high calorie content, eating moderate amounts of pure peanut butter or whole peanuts is perfectly fine on a weight-loss diet ( 11 ).

What is healthy fat?

Monounsaturated fats and polyunsaturated fats are known as the “good fats” because they are good for your heart, your cholesterol, and your overall health. These fats can help to: Lower the risk of heart disease and stroke. Lower bad LDL cholesterol levels, while increasing good HDL.

How much fat is OK per day?

The dietary reference intake (DRI) for fat in adults is 20% to 35% of total calories from fat. That is about 44 grams to 77 grams of fat per day if you eat 2,000 calories a day. It is recommended to eat more of some types of fats because they provide health benefits.

Can cheese be good for you?

It's a good source of nutrients

Cheese is a great source of calcium, fat, and protein. It also contains high amounts of vitamins A and B12, along with zinc, phosphorus, and riboflavin. According to U.S. Dairy, the overall nutritional profile of conventional, organic, and grass-fed dairy products is similar.

What 3 foods cardiologists say to avoid?

“Avoid any foods that have the words 'trans,' 'hydrogenated,' or 'partially hydrogenated' on the label [indicating bad fats], often found in commercially fried foods, donuts, cookies and potato chips,” advises Dr. DeVane. “Also, be aware of how many calories are coming from sugar.

Is oatmeal healthy?

Oats are among the healthiest grains on earth. They're a gluten-free whole grain and a great source of important vitamins, minerals, fiber, and antioxidants. Studies show that oats and oatmeal have many health benefits. These include weight loss, lower blood sugar levels, and a reduced risk of heart disease.

Does bread make you fat?

Because contrary to popular belief, bread does not make you fat. In fact, there isn't any one food that makes you fat. Weight gain occurs when you eat more calories than you burn. These extra un-burned calories could come from bread, but they could also come from anything else you eat.

What fruit has the most fat?

Avocados are unique in the world of fruits. Whereas most fruits primarily contain carbs, avocados are loaded with fats. In fact, avocados are about 80% fat, by calories, making them even higher in fat than most animal foods ( 3 ).
